Open Source ID Card Printing Software: A Comprehensive Guide

Are you in need of a reliable and efficient solution for printing ID cards? Look no further than open source ID card printing software. In this blog article, we will explore the world of open source software that allows you to design and print ID cards with ease. Whether you are a small business owner, a school administrator, or a government agency, open source ID card printing software provides a cost-effective and customizable solution for all your ID card needs.

In this comprehensive guide, we will discuss the benefits of using open source software for ID card printing, provide an overview of the top open source options available, and guide you through the process of selecting the right software for your specific requirements. Join us as we delve into the world of open source ID card printing software and unlock its potential for your organization.

Understanding Open Source Software

Open source software refers to computer programs that are freely available for anyone to use, modify, and distribute. Unlike proprietary software, where the source code is kept secret and controlled by a single entity, open source software encourages collaboration and community-driven development. This means that developers from around the world can contribute to the improvement of the software, resulting in a more robust and feature-rich product.

One of the main advantages of open source software is its cost-effectiveness. Since it is freely available, organizations can save significant costs on licensing fees that would be associated with proprietary software. Additionally, open source software offers greater flexibility and customization options. Users have the freedom to modify the software to suit their specific needs, adding or removing features as required.

The Advantages of Open Source Software

Open source software comes with a range of advantages that make it an attractive choice for ID card printing. Firstly, open source software is highly customizable. Users can modify the software to add specific features or integrate it with other systems, such as databases or access control systems. This level of customization ensures that the software meets the unique requirements of each organization.

Another advantage of open source software is the active community behind it. Many open source projects have a large community of developers who contribute to the improvement and maintenance of the software. This means that bugs and security vulnerabilities are quickly identified and resolved, ensuring that the software remains reliable and secure.

Open source software also offers a greater degree of transparency. Since the source code is freely available, users can inspect and validate the software for any potential security risks or backdoors. This level of transparency provides peace of mind, especially for organizations that handle sensitive information on their ID cards.

Community-Driven Development

The collaborative nature of open source software development is one of its most significant advantages. With open source projects, developers from around the world can contribute their expertise and insights to improve the software. This results in faster development cycles and more frequent updates, ensuring that the software remains up-to-date with the latest industry standards and user requirements.

The open source community also fosters innovation. Developers can build upon existing open source projects to create new and innovative solutions. This means that open source ID card printing software is constantly evolving, with new features and functionalities being introduced regularly.

Why Choose Open Source ID Card Printing Software?

Open source ID card printing software offers a range of benefits that make it a compelling choice for organizations. Firstly, open source software is cost-effective. Since it is freely available, organizations can save significant costs on licensing fees associated with proprietary software. This makes open source software particularly attractive for small businesses, schools, and government agencies with limited budgets.

Another advantage of open source ID card printing software is its flexibility. Open source software allows users to customize and modify the software to suit their specific requirements. This means that organizations can add or remove features, integrate the software with existing systems, and tailor it to their unique workflows. With open source software, you have full control over your ID card printing process.

Customization Options

One of the key advantages of open source ID card printing software is the ability to customize the software to meet your organization’s specific requirements. Unlike proprietary software, where you are limited to the features and functionalities provided by the vendor, open source software allows you to modify the software to add or remove features as needed.

For example, if your organization requires integration with a specific database or access control system, you can customize the open source software to seamlessly integrate with those systems. This level of customization ensures that the software fits perfectly into your existing workflows and processes, saving time and increasing efficiency.

Cost Savings

Open source ID card printing software offers significant cost savings compared to proprietary alternatives. With proprietary software, you are required to pay licensing fees for each user or device that is using the software. These licensing fees can quickly add up, especially for organizations with a large number of employees or students.

On the other hand, open source software is freely available for anyone to use. This means that you can install the software on as many computers or devices as needed without incurring any additional costs. The cost savings associated with open source software can be substantial, allowing organizations to allocate their budgets to other critical areas.

Security and Reliability

When it comes to ID card printing, security is of utmost importance. Open source ID card printing software offers a high level of security and reliability. The open source nature of the software allows users to inspect and validate the code for any potential security risks or vulnerabilities. This level of transparency provides peace of mind, especially for organizations that handle sensitive information on their ID cards.

Additionally, open source software benefits from the active community behind it. With a large community of developers, bugs and security vulnerabilities are quickly identified and resolved. Updates and patches are released regularly, ensuring that the software remains secure and reliable.

Top Open Source ID Card Printing Software

Now that we have explored the benefits of using open source software for ID card printing, let’s take a closer look at some of the top open source options available in the market. These software solutions offer a range of features and functionalities to meet the diverse needs of organizations.

1. OpenCards

OpenCards is a powerful open source ID card printing software that offers advanced design capabilities and seamless integration with databases. With OpenCards, you can easily create professional-looking ID cards with customizable templates, images, and data fields. The software supports various card sizes and printing technologies, allowing you to choose the best option for your specific requirements. OpenCards also offers extensive database integration options, making it easy to import and manage data for your ID cards.

2. IDCreator

IDCreator is another popular open source ID card printing software that offers a user-friendly interface and a wide range of design options. With IDCreator, you can create ID cards from scratch or choose from a library of pre-designed templates. The software supports various card sizes and printing technologies, allowing you to print high-quality ID cards with ease. IDCreator also offers advanced database integration capabilities, making it easy to import and manage data for your ID cards.

3. CardStudio

CardStudio is a comprehensive open source ID card printing software that offers a range of design and printing options. With CardStudio, you can create professional-looking ID cards with customizable templates, images, and data fields. The software supports various card sizes and printing technologies, allowing you to choose the best option for your specific requirements. CardStudio also offers advanced database integration options, making it easy to import and manage data for your ID cards.

4. BadgeMaker

BadgeMaker is a versatile open source ID card printing software that offers a user-friendly interface and a wide range of design options. With BadgeMaker, you can create ID cards from scratch or choose from a library of pre-designed templates. The software supports various card sizes and printing technologies, allowing you to print high-quality ID cards with ease. BadgeMaker also offers advanced database integration capabilities, making it easy to import and manage data for your ID cards.

5. EasyBadge

EasyBadge is a user-friendly open source ID card printing software that offers a simple and intuitive interface. With EasyBadge, you can easily design and print ID cards with customizable templates, images, and data fields. The software supports various card sizes and printing technologies, allowing you to choose the best option for your specific requirements. EasyBadge also offers basic database integration options, making it easy to import and manage data for your ID cards.

Features to Consider in Open Source ID Card Printing Software

When evaluating open source ID card printing software, it is essential to consider the features and functionalities that are important for your organization. Here are some key features to consider:

1. Design Capabilities

Design capabilities are crucial when it comes to creating professional-looking ID cards. Look for software that offers a wide range of design options, such as customizable templates, images, and data fields. The ability to add logos, photos, and barcodes can also be beneficial for enhancing the visual appeal and functionality of your ID cards.

2. Database Integration

Database integration is essential for efficiently managing data for your ID cards. Look for software that offers seamless integration with databases, allowing you to import and manage data easily. The ability to link ID cards with existing database systems, such as employee or student databases, can save time and prevent data duplication.

3.3. Printing Options and Configurations

Printing options and configurations play a vital role in achieving high-quality and professional ID card prints. Look for open source ID card printing software that offers a variety of printing options, such as single-sided or double-sided printing, color or monochrome printing, and different printing technologies like direct-to-card or retransfer printing. The software should also allow you to configure print settings, such as card size, resolution, and alignment, to ensure accurate and consistent printing results.

4. Integration with Existing Systems

Integration with existing systems is crucial for streamlined workflows and efficient ID card production. Consider open source ID card printing software that offers seamless integration with other systems, such as access control systems or HR databases. This integration allows for automatic data synchronization, eliminating manual data entry and reducing the risk of errors. Look for software that supports common integration protocols, such as LDAP or API, to ensure compatibility with your existing systems.

5. Security Features

Security is a top priority when it comes to ID card printing, especially for organizations handling sensitive information. Look for open source ID card printing software that offers robust security features, such as encryption of data transmission and storage, user access controls to restrict unauthorized printing, and the ability to add watermarks or holograms for enhanced card security. Additionally, the software should provide audit trails and logging capabilities to track and monitor card printing activities.

6. User-Friendly Interface

A user-friendly interface is essential for ease of use and efficient operation of the ID card printing software. Look for open source software that offers an intuitive and user-friendly interface, with clear navigation and easily accessible tools. The software should provide drag-and-drop functionality, customizable toolbars, and on-screen guides to simplify the design and printing process. Additionally, the software should offer a preview feature that allows you to visualize the final ID card before printing.

7. Support and Documentation

When selecting open source ID card printing software, consider the availability of support and documentation. Look for software that provides comprehensive user guides, tutorials, and FAQs to assist you in getting started and troubleshooting any issues that may arise. Additionally, check if there is an active community or forum where users can seek help, share experiences, and exchange ideas. Some open source projects also offer professional support services for organizations that require additional assistance.

Step-by-Step Guide: Designing ID Cards with Open Source Software

Designing ID cards with open source software is a straightforward process that can be accomplished in a few simple steps. Follow this step-by-step guide to create professional-looking ID cards using open source ID card printing software:

Step 1: Install the Software

Start by downloading and installing the open source ID card printing software on your computer. Follow the installation instructions provided by the software developer to ensure a smooth installation process.

Step 2: Set Up the Software

Once the software is installed, launch it and configure the settings according to your preferences. This may include selecting the language, setting up database connections, and adjusting print settings such as card size and resolution.

Step 3: Design the ID Card

Begin the design process by creating a new ID card template or selecting a pre-designed template from the software’s library. Customize the template by adding your organization’s logo, employee or student details, and any other desired information. Incorporate design elements such as images, barcodes, or QR codes to enhance the functionality and aesthetics of the ID card.

Step 4: Add Data Fields

If you are using a database to manage ID card data, you can easily import the necessary data fields into the ID card template. Map the data fields from your database to the corresponding fields on the ID card template. This ensures that the information printed on the ID cards is accurate and up-to-date.

Step 5: Preview and Edit

Before finalizing the design, take advantage of the software’s preview feature to visualize how the ID card will look once printed. Check for any errors or inconsistencies and make any necessary edits to ensure a polished and professional design.

Step 6: Print the ID Cards

Once you are satisfied with the design, it’s time to print the ID cards. Ensure that your printer is properly connected and loaded with the appropriate card stock. Select the desired print options, such as single-sided or double-sided printing, and specify the number of copies needed. Start the printing process and wait for the ID cards to be produced.

Step 7: Test and Evaluate

After printing the ID cards, perform a quality check to ensure that the prints are accurate and meet your expectations. Evaluate the overall process, from design to printing, and identify any areas for improvement. This feedback can help refine your ID card printing workflow and ensure consistent, high-quality results in the future.

Conclusion

Open source ID card printing software offers a cost-effective and customizable solution for organizations in need of reliable ID card printing capabilities. With a wide range of features and functionalities, open source software allows for flexibility, customization, and integration with existing systems. By carefully evaluating your organization’s requirements and selecting the right open source software, you can streamline the ID card printing process, enhance security, and achieve professional-looking ID cards.

In this comprehensive guide, we have explored the benefits of using open source ID card printing software, provided an overview of the top open source options available, and outlined the key features to consider when selecting software for your organization. We also presented a step-by-step guide to designing ID cards using open source software, ensuring a smooth and efficient workflow.

Embrace the power of open source and unlock the potential of ID card printing software for your organization. With open source software, you can achieve cost savings, customization options, and enhanced security, all while producing professional-looking ID cards that meet your unique requirements.

Related video of Open Source ID Card Printing Software: A Comprehensive Guide